The Foreign Ministers of 6 Arab Countries meet in Jordan

On 31 January, the FM of Egypt, Bahrain, UAE, Saudi Arabia, Jordan and Kuwait met in Jordan to coordinate their position in several regional issues. On 30 January they arrived in Amman where they met the Jordanian King Abdullah II. The Monarch stressed “the importance of coordinating Arab positions on regional issues”. The Syrian re-admission to the AL and the crisis with Qatar were some of the issues on the table. The Jordanian Foreign Minister Ayman Safadi described the meeting as “positive and constructive”.
